Re: Nokia 5800 NAM loses tag info on some songs.
working now, apparently. connect phone w usb
wait until its identified, independent of mode
change or confirm mode to mass transfer
configure device synchronization settings
I have "copy playlists...", "Sync all album art" and "Use only the first genre" enabled
I'm converting flac to mp3 on the go, v0 quality, 44100, Highest quality, bit resevoir
You can check still in MM if the folder shows the songs with all tags
Hit "Safely remove hardware"
On the phone, update music library
worked here in the past 5 syncs. I'll post again if it fails on later attempts.
